Our Hoarding Cleanup Services Include:
- Removal of all clutter and debris.
- Hazardous waste removal, including animal droppings and other biohazards.
- Valuable items recovered such as jewelry and hidden money.
- Coordinate recycling and shredding.
- Help distribute donations.
- Assist in distributing kept items to family members (local and national).
- Help to facilitate any paperwork requirement for local governments or agencies.

Nixa MO Fun Facts
The area was first settled by farmers who located their farms along the wooded streams near present-day Nixa.[7] The area became a crossroads, as it was a half-day ride with a team of horses from Springfield.[7]Teamsters found it a convenient stopover site when hauling freight between Springfield and Arkansas.[7] The village became known as Faughts.[8] An early resident, Nicholas A. Inman, was a blacksmith from Tennessee, who set up a shop in 1852.[7] When a post office was opened, a town meeting was held to decide on a name for the new community. Because of his years of service to the community, the town was suggested to be named for him.[7] Another suggestion was “nix” because the community was “nothing but a crossroads”.[7] The name Nix was finally decided upon, and Inman’s middle initial “a” was added to get the unique name of Nixa.[7] The village incorporated on June 10, 1902.[7]
